#qodef-top-area {
  display: none !important;
}
#qodef-page-header {
  padding-top: 1.5em;
  padding-bottom: 3em;
  height: 12em !important;
  background-color: #fcfbf7;
}
#qodef-page-header #qodef-page-header-inner .qodef-header-logo-link {
  margin: 1em;
}
#qodef-page-header .hide-text-label > a:first-child span:last-child {
  display: none;
}
#qodef-page-mobile-header #qodef-page-mobile-header-inner a:first-child {
  margin: auto;
}
#qodef-page-mobile-header #qodef-page-mobile-header-inner a:last-child {
  position: absolute;
}
